服务器算力是什么意思,服务器算力全解析,从定义到实践的技术指南与性能优化策略
- 综合资讯
- 2025-04-17 18:21:34
- 2

服务器算力指服务器硬件与软件协同实现的计算能力,核心指标包括数据处理速度、多任务处理效率和资源利用率,其硬件基础涵盖CPU核心数与主频、内存容量与带宽、存储IOPS、网...
服务器算力指服务器硬件与软件协同实现的计算能力,核心指标包括数据处理速度、多任务处理效率和资源利用率,其硬件基础涵盖CPU核心数与主频、内存容量与带宽、存储IOPS、网络吞吐量及电源冗余等,软件层面涉及操作系统调度算法、虚拟化技术及负载均衡策略,性能优化需从四维度切入:1)硬件选型时平衡CPU单核性能与多线程效率,选择适配业务场景的存储介质;2)采用容器化与KVM虚拟化技术提升资源利用率,配合NUMA优化减少内存访问延迟;3)部署Zabbix、Prometheus等监控工具实现实时负载热力图分析,设置自动扩缩容阈值;4)通过Bottleneck分析定位性能瓶颈,结合RDMA网络和SSD缓存加速数据传输,企业应建立算力分级管理制度,针对AI训练、高频交易等场景配置专用加速卡,同时优化散热设计(如冷热通道隔离)保障7×24小时稳定运行,最终实现P95响应时间降低40%以上的性能提升。
(全文约4360字)
服务器算力的核心定义与技术内涵 1.1 算力的本质概念 服务器算力(Server Computing Power)是衡量服务器硬件系统在单位时间内完成特定计算任务能力的综合指标,其本质体现为处理器核心运算能力、内存带宽、存储吞吐量以及网络传输效率的协同作用,不同于普通计算机的算力评估,服务器算力需满足以下特征:
- 高并发处理能力:支持多线程并行运算(如32核CPU同时处理64个线程)
- 稳定持续输出:7×24小时不间断运行保障(需达到99.999%可用性标准)
- 扩展兼容性:支持从4路到8路CPU的模块化升级(如SuperServer 4U机架式架构)
- 热插拔冗余:双路电源+热插拔硬盘支持(如Dell PowerEdge R750)
2 算力评估的技术维度 现代服务器算力评估需构建多维指标体系:
- 基础运算能力:CPU浮点运算性能(FP32/FLOPS)、整数运算能力(INT32/MIPS)
- 并行处理能力:多核调度效率(如AMD EPYC 7763的128MB L3缓存)
- 存储性能:NVMe SSD的PCIe 5.0 x16通道带宽(可达12GB/s连续读写)
- 网络吞吐量:25Gbps万兆网卡的双端口聚合能力(10Gbps×2)
- 能效比:每瓦特算力输出(如华为FusionServer 2288H V5的1.2Tbps/W)
服务器算力计算方法与公式体系 2.1 硬件参数计算模型 (1)CPU算力计算公式: 理论峰值算力 = (CPU核心数 × 线程数) × 单核主频 × 指令集效率系数 实际应用中需考虑:
图片来源于网络,如有侵权联系删除
- 核心利用率因子(0.7-0.85)
- 指令集差异系数(AVX-512指令提升3-5倍)
- 虚拟化开销(VMware ESXi增加15-20%损耗)
(2)存储系统IOPS计算: IOPS = (存储容量 × 1000) / (单盘容量 × 执行时间) × 批次因子 16块1TB硬盘RAID10阵列,理论IOPS可达: (16×1000)/(1×60) × 4 = 1066.67 IOPS(考虑4K块大小)
2 实际应用场景计算模型 (1)视频渲染算力需求: 单帧渲染时间 = (分辨率×像素量) / (GPU CUDA核心数 × 着色器效率) 例如4K视频(3840×2160=8,294,400像素): 单帧时间 = 8,294,400 / (2480 × 0.85) ≈ 3.12秒/帧
(2)数据库查询性能: 查询响应时间 = (数据量 × 索引匹配效率) / (CPU核心数 × 内存带宽) 某MySQL集群处理10GB数据: 响应时间 = (10×1024×1024 × 0.7) / (32 × 64) ≈ 0.36秒
影响服务器算力的关键要素分析 3.1 硬件架构设计 (1)CPU架构演进:
- x86架构:Intel Xeon Scalable与AMD EPYC的对比(如EPYC 9654的128MB缓存)
- ARM架构:AWS Graviton3处理器的能效比提升(1.5倍于x86)
- 存算一体架构:华为昇腾910B的存算比优化(256Tbps带宽)
(2)内存子系统:
- DDR5内存特性:6400MT/s频率 × 3D堆叠(72层)
- 内存通道数:四通道服务器内存带宽可达128GB/s
- 内存一致性:RDMA内存共享技术(延迟<5μs)
2 软件优化空间 (1)编译器优化:
- GCC 13.1.0的-Ofast选项提升23%
- Intel C++编译器优化(-O3 -march=native)
- OpenMP并行化效率(最大线程数受CPU核心数限制)
(2)调度算法:
- CFS调度器优化(Linux 5.15版本改进) -NUMA优化:内存访问延迟降低40%(如Intel NUMA优化指南)
- GPU调度:NVIDIA Nvlink带宽分配算法(128GB显存→256GB虚拟显存)
典型应用场景下的算力需求分析 4.1 大数据计算场景 Hadoop集群算力需求计算: YARN任务调度效率 = (节点数 × CPU核心数) / (Map任务并行度 × Shuffle延迟) 某集群处理100TB数据: 节点数 = 100TB / (8核×4TB/节点) = 25节点 Map任务数 = 100TB / 128MB = 78125任务 并行度 = 25节点 × 8核 = 200核 → 任务完成时间=78125/200=390秒
2 AI训练场景 TensorFlow训练效率公式: 训练时间 = (模型参数量 × 训练轮数) / (GPU显存×混合精度效率) 某ResNet-50模型(25M参数): 显存占用=25M×4×2=200MB → 8块A100(40GB×8)=320GB显存 训练时间=25×1000 / (320×0.75) ≈ 83.85小时
3 云计算服务场景 云服务器算力配额计算: vCPU利用率 = (请求TPS × 数据包大小) / (物理核心数 × 时延预算) 某云数据库TPS=5000,数据包=256B,时延<50ms: vCPU数= (5000×256×8)/(2.5GHz×50×10^-3) ≈ 40.96 → 42vCPU
服务器算力优化策略与实践 5.1 硬件层面优化 (1)CPU配置策略:
- 双路服务器:选择L3缓存共享架构(如Intel Xeon Gold 6338)
- 四路服务器:采用交叉互连(Cross-Link)技术提升带宽
- 多路服务器:配置专用I/O通道(如IBM Power9的8路系统)
(2)存储优化方案:
- SSD tiering:SSD缓存层(25GB)+HDD存储层(10TB)
- ZFS优化:启用async写+压缩算法(zstd-1)
- NVMe-oF:全闪存阵列(4×7.68TB×RAID10)
2 软件层面优化 (1)虚拟化优化:
- HVM模式选择:Intel VT-x vs AMD-Vi
- NUMA绑定:为虚拟机分配物理CPU顺序
- 虚拟化开销:KVM vs VMware ESXi(内存占用差15%)
(2)网络优化:
- TCP拥塞控制:CUBIC算法优化
- 负载均衡策略:IPVS vs L4代理
- QoS设置:802.1Q标签优先级(VoIP流量标记)
3 能效管理技术 (1)电源管理:
- 智能电源分配单元(iPMU):动态调整12V/5V电压
- 动态频率调节:Intel SpeedStep技术(频率范围1.2-3.8GHz)
- 空闲状态休眠:ACPI S3模式(唤醒时间<1秒)
(2)散热优化:
- 三维温控系统:红外热成像+液冷管路
- 动态风扇控制:SmartFan 2.0算法(噪音<35dB)
- 存储阵列散热:热插拔风道设计(横向气流)
未来算力发展趋势与挑战 6.1 技术演进方向 (1)量子计算融合:IBM Q4量子比特与经典服务器互联架构 (2)光互连技术:100G光模块(400G单通道)成本下降曲线 (3)存算一体芯片:三星HBM3D内存带宽突破2TB/s
2 性能瓶颈突破 (1)CPU指令集革新:AVX-512扩展指令集(512位寄存器) (2)内存带宽提升:DDR5-8400(12800MT/s)→DDR6-8400(14400MT/s) (3)存储接口演进:NVMe over Fabrics(NVMf)协议标准化
3 能效挑战与解决方案 (1)PUE优化:谷歌甲烷冷却系统(PUE=1.1) (2)可再生能源:阿里云"绿能服务器"(100%绿电) (3)液冷技术:浸没式冷却(3.5W/cm²散热密度)
典型服务器配置案例对比 7.1 云计算场景配置 (1)中小型业务:
图片来源于网络,如有侵权联系删除
- 4路服务器:2×Intel Xeon Gold 6338(28核56线程)
- 内存:64GB×4通道DDR5
- 存储:2×2TB SSD RAID10
- 网络:双25Gbps网卡聚合
(2)大型业务:
- 8路服务器:2×AMD EPYC 9654(96核192线程)
- 内存:512GB×4通道DDR5
- 存储:8×7.68TB NVMe RAID6
- 网络:四25Gbps网卡TR-25标准
2 AI训练场景配置 (1)推理服务:
- 4×NVIDIA A100(40GB×4)
- 512GB DDR5内存
- 8×4TB SSD RAID10
- 100Gbps InfiniBand网络
(2)训练服务:
- 8×NVIDIA H100(80GB×8)
- 2TB HBM3内存
- 16×8TB SSD RAID6
- 400Gbps以太网交换机
服务器算力评估工具与方法 8.1 硬件诊断工具 (1)CPU诊断:
- IntelBurnTest:压力测试单核性能
- AMD StressTest:多核负载均衡测试
(2)存储测试:
- CrystalDiskMark:4K随机读写测试
- fio工具:自定义IOPS压力测试
2 性能监控工具 (1)系统级监控:
- Prometheus+Grafana:实时指标可视化
- elasticsearch+Kibana:日志分析平台
(2)应用级监控:
- New Relic:应用性能追踪
- Datadog:全链路监控
3 算力评估方法 (1)基准测试:
- SpecCPU2017:整数/浮点性能测试
- SpecJBB2020:Java并发性能基准
- MLPerf:机器学习框架效率评估
(2)实际负载测试:
- 模拟用户并发数(JMeter 5.5+)
- 数据吞吐量压力测试(Postman+Loopback)
- 持续运行稳定性测试( StressAPM)
常见误区与解决方案 9.1 算力计算误区 (1)错误公式:单核性能=主频×核心数(实际受缓存带宽限制) (2)忽略因素:虚拟化层带来的15-30%性能损耗 (3)存储瓶颈:SSD写入速度限制(如1000MB/s写入→查询延迟增加)
2 典型场景解决方案 (1)视频渲染优化:
- 使用NVIDIA Omniverse框架(加速比3-5倍)
- 多GPU协作渲染(4×RTX 6000 Ada)
- CPU+GPU混合渲染(CPU处理几何,GPU处理着色)
(2)数据库优化:
- 索引优化:使用BRIN索引替代B+树
- 分库分表:ShardingSphere实现水平分片
- 缓存策略:Redis+Memcached混合缓存(命中率>98%)
(3)虚拟化优化:
- 智能分配:根据应用类型分配CPU核心(Web应用4核,数据库16核)
- 资源隔离:cGroup v2实现内存/IO限制
- 虚拟化方式:选择KVM而非HVM(节省20%资源)
未来展望与建议 10.1 技术发展趋势 (1)异构计算架构:CPU+GPU+NPU协同(如华为昇腾+鲲鹏) (2)边缘计算算力:5G MEC服务器(延迟<10ms) (3)可持续算力:液冷+可再生能源融合(如微软北极数据中心)
2 实践建议 (1)架构设计:
- 采用模块化设计(支持热插拔升级)
- 预留20%算力冗余(应对业务增长)
- 实施分层存储架构(SSD缓存+HDD存储)
(2)运维策略:
- 定期压力测试(每月全负载测试)
- 实施自动化监控(告警阈值动态调整)
- 建立性能基线(每月更新基准数据)
(3)人员培养:
- 掌握多维度监控工具(Prometheus+Zabbix)
- 学习容器化技术(Kubernetes资源调度)
- 熟悉新型硬件架构(HBM3+DDR5+GPU)
服务器算力作为数字经济的核心驱动力,其计算与优化已超越单纯的技术参数比较,演变为涵盖硬件架构、软件生态、应用场景的复杂系统工程,随着量子计算、光互连等新技术突破,算力评估模型将面临根本性变革,企业需建立动态评估体系,在性能、成本、能效之间寻求最优平衡点,方能在算力竞赛中持续保持竞争优势。
(全文共计4360字,满足原创性及字数要求)
本文链接:https://www.zhitaoyun.cn/2134767.html
发表评论